Forest Hill Football Netball Club is seeking a Head Trainer for its Seniors and Reserves Teams. The ideal candidate will be somebody who is passionate, motivated and enjoys working within a team environment. |
The successful candidate will be required to; • Attend 2 training sessions per week (Monday/Wednesday during Pre-season and Tuesday/Thursday during the Season) to perform pre-training and match day services, including injury management/rehabilitation, player taping and massage as required. • Treat player injuries and recommend further rehab/medical advice • Keep accurate records of player injuries and report to coaching staff on a weekly basis • Ensure that required medical equipment are available at all training sessions and matches Requirements • Ability to handle on-field mobility demands and maintain a sound level of fitness due to the running involved on match day • Ability to work within a team environment • Have a can-do attitude and ready to be involved in the social aspect of the club Essential Requirements • Availability for all training sessions (2 per week) and match days from 10.30am • Current Level 1 Sports Medicine Australia (SMA) Sports Trainer Certificate |
